Transaction 52566fcf96aca080914f1a3349d7cfc9bac21c038e3465dceacc79b1fecf8b86

1 Input
2 Outputs
  • 52566fcf96aca080914f1a3349d7cfc9bac21c038e3465dceacc79b1fecf8b86:0
  • value  67638747
    address  16yHX4VJzVpMr1HCJM9LrkyjtFqzSiDxJd
  • 52566fcf96aca080914f1a3349d7cfc9bac21c038e3465dceacc79b1fecf8b86:1
  • value  2425713
    address  1KvP4QJXrUg8WtGipdVDv2US169MyESEKk